SB 3020·IL·senate

DOMESTIC VIOLENCE-HARASSMENT

Sent to ExecutiveFiled Jan 29, 2026
Sponsor: Adriane Johnson (D)
Latest Action

Sent to the Governor

Jun 29, 2026

Summary

The bill broadens the legal definition of harassment to cover digital actions such as doxing, manipulated sexual images, and electronic tracking. It authorizes courts to order perpetrators to stop these behaviors and to prove they have complied. The changes also update the Illinois Domestic Violence Act to match the new rules.
